Yes Griz, you will score different points, and yes in that scenario you would get a different amount of perk points.
My point is that the perk point system already balances the difference's between planes flown, objects destroyed, etc.
So why not use it? 
Not that I'm unhappy with the system now, especially since the patch adjusted it. 
As for fighters thats a moot point. But say we the landing message for fighters was changed to show perks received instead of kills landed.  Your going to get more perks for flying a good sortie in a C.205 than you are a Nik.
And the text buffer would show that. Thats my whole point, the perk system already adjusts for degree of hardness both in the plane flown, and what your killing. And yes, for ENY also, your going to make more points when your outnumbered. 
So in order to land a 10 perk sortie you might have to switch to the low numbered side.
Now wouldn't that do things for gameplay?  
Not to mention encouraging more people to fly other than the spit 16, P51, and F4u.
Not that I'm advocating changing kills landed, but if you did, how could you get more fair than to use the perk system?
Back on subject, damage done is fine, and inside a tour everyone will know whats a good bomber sortie and what one where they only hit half their targets looks like. You can't go by objects, because 1 hanger or 1 ship is a single object.
HQ building is 1 object.  Where a town it is easy to scroll up 20 or more with a single pass.  So its either Damage inflicted, or perks earned. Hitech chose this way and as the one who asked for it at con, I'm fine with his choice.
Especially after the patch adjusted things.